If you aren’t looking for a long-term solution but would rather call a specific person without showing your number, you can block your caller ID on a per-call basis using a special code as a prefix to the number you want to call. In the US, that code is *67. In certain European countries, that code is #31#.Select Settings . Tap Calls, or Calling accounts if you see that instead. What to Know. Dial *67 before the area code of the number to block your Caller ID from showing up on the person's phone. For certain cell service providers, you can block your Caller ID from your iPhone's Settings. If you've toggled off Caller ID, you can temporarily share your number by dialing *82 before the area code.

This article explains how to block phone numbers on iOS and ...Feb 28, 2022 · If you only want to block your number to for specific calls, enter *67 immediately before the number: e.g., *67 555 555 5555. If you have AT&T in the US or you are in other countries than the US you may have to use #31# instead of *67 - experiment. If you call a toll-free number there is no way to block your caller ID.
